MASS Design Group

Posted March 20, 2024

Designer/Architect and Senior Architect

MASS is seeking a designer/architect (3-7 yrs experience) and a senior architect (5-10 yrs experience) to join our team in Santa Fe, New Mexico.

 

Our Santa Fe Studio specializes in designing culturally-responsive and socially-impactful places that reflect the unique context and heritage of the region. Our thirteen-person team brings decades of experience working in the area and a deep understanding of the cultural and ecological heritage of the North American West. We work with communities to design and develop housing, healthcare and educational facilities, community centers, and spaces that preserve and uplift public memory. Additionally, our studio is home to the Sustainable Native Communities Design Lab (SNCDL), which focuses on building wealth, opportunity, and resilience in Indian Country. 

 

Our office and firm are excited to be growing the field of architecture with individuals representing diverse backgrounds and ranges of experiences. MASS offers competitive salary and benefits, including a hybrid work policy, minimum three-week vacation policy, paid parental leave, 401k, health care insurance, among others. Applicants must be technically strong, have excellent written communication and data analysis skills, and be able to perform with limited supervision and work on a range of diverse project tasks.
